Hamilton reveals secret to Bottas extension: He makes me look good!
The Finn was given a new deal this week.
Lewis Hamilton joked that he is happy for Valtteri Bottas to continue driving for Mercedes as the Finn makes him look younger.
On Thursday ahead of the Belgian Grand Prix, Mercedes announced that Bottas will be staying with the team for the 2020 campaign, despite speculation before the summer break that he could be replaced by either George Russell or Esteban Ocon.
Hamilton has always enjoyed a courteous relationship with Bottas, especially compared to his fractured one with Nico Rosberg, and is happy to continue the partnership with the Silver Arrows.
Hamilton smiled at Spa: "He makes me look good because he looks older than me, even though he's younger than me, so that's always a good thing!

"Honestly, it's really just the rapport..
“We've always had respect between us and that's not really very common, particularly when it's so competitive.
"He wakes up and wants to beat me. I wake up and I naturally want to beat him, but we shake each other's hands as men.
"The energy's just really nice within the organisation.
"When we're in the office and we get in the car we try and do the best job we can. We don’t come back and bring in any negativity and pull down individuals within the team. It’s always quite uplifting no matter what."
Mercedes are set to win sixth consecutive constructors’ championship this season, having dominated in the V6 hybrid era, and Hamilton praised the atmosphere within the team.

"I think continuity is always a great thing,” Hamilton said. "I think we have a great environment that we work in, we've created over time.
"It's going to be the fourth year. We have a great working relationship, Valtteri and I.
"I think it was a smart decision from the team, to be honest, and I really look forward to working with him. I really enjoy working with him in general. We get on well both outside and on the track."
